You are viewing a plain text version of this content. The canonical link for it is here.
Posted to fop-commits@xmlgraphics.apache.org by ss...@apache.org on 2015/02/06 16:58:52 UTC

svn commit: r1657875 - /xm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SPainter.java

Author: ssteiner
Date: Fri Feb  6 15:58:52 2015
New Revision: 1657875

URL: http://svn.apache.org/r1657875
Log:
FOP-2432: OTF font NPE

Modified:
    xm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SPainter.java

Modified: xm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SPainter.java
URL: http://svn.apache.org/viewvc/xm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SPainter.java?rev=1657875&r1=1657874&r2=1657875&view=diff
==============================================================================
--- xm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SPainter.java (original)
+++ xmlgraphics/fop/trunk/src/java/org/apache/fop/render/ps/PSPainter.java Fri Feb  6 15:58:52 2015
@@ -422,6 +422,7 @@ public class PSPainter extends AbstractI
                         char orgChar = text.charAt(i);
 
                         MultiByteFont mbFont = (MultiByteFont)tf;
+                        mbFont.mapChar(orgChar);
                         int origGlyphIdx = mbFont.findGlyphIndex(orgChar);
                         int newGlyphIdx = mbFont.getUsedGlyphs().get(origGlyphIdx);
                         int encoding = newGlyphIdx / 256;



---------------------------------------------------------------------
To unsubscribe, e-mail: fop-commits-unsubscribe@xmlgraphics.apache.org
For additional commands, e-mail: fop-commits-help@xmlgraphics.apache.org